// Copyright 2020 The Chromium Authors. All rights reserved. // Use of this source code is governed by a BSD-style license that can be // found in the LICENSE file. import type * as SDK from '../../core/sdk/sdk.js'; import * as Bindings from '../bindings/bindings.js'; import {type Chrome} from '../../../extension-api/ExtensionAPI.js'; // eslint-disable-line rulesdir/es_modules_import import {ExtensionEndpoint} from './ExtensionEndpoint.js'; import {PrivateAPI} from './ExtensionAPI.js'; class LanguageExtensionEndpointImpl extends ExtensionEndpoint { private plugin: LanguageExtensionEndpoint; constructor(plugin: LanguageExtensionEndpoint, port: MessagePort) { super(port); this.plugin = plugin; } protected override handleEvent({event}: {event: string}): void { switch (event) { case PrivateAPI.LanguageExtensionPluginEvents.UnregisteredLanguageExtensionPlugin: { this.disconnect(); const {pluginManager} = Bindings.DebuggerWorkspaceBinding.DebuggerWorkspaceBinding.instance(); if (pluginManager) { pluginManager.removePlugin(this.plugin); } break; } } } } export class LanguageExtensionEndpoint implements Bindings.DebuggerLanguagePlugins.DebuggerLanguagePlugin { private readonly supportedScriptTypes: { language: string, // TODO(crbug.com/1172300) Ignored during the jsdoc to ts migration // eslint-disable-next-line @typescript-eslint/naming-convention symbol_types: Array<string>, }; private endpoint: LanguageExtensionEndpointImpl; name: string; constructor( name: string, supportedScriptTypes: { language: string, // TODO(crbug.com/1172300) Ignored during the jsdoc to ts migration // eslint-disable-next-line @typescript-eslint/naming-convention symbol_types: Array<string>, }, port: MessagePort) { this.name = name; this.supportedScriptTypes = supportedScriptTypes; this.endpoint = new LanguageExtensionEndpointImpl(this, port); } handleScript(script: SDK.Script.Script): boolean { const language = script.scriptLanguage(); return language !== null && script.debugSymbols !== null && language === this.supportedScriptTypes.language && this.supportedScriptTypes.symbol_types.includes(script.debugSymbols.type); } /** Notify the plugin about a new script */ addRawModule(rawModuleId: string, symbolsURL: string, rawModule: Chrome.DevTools.RawModule): Promise<string[]> { return this.endpoint.sendRequest( PrivateAPI.LanguageExtensionPluginCommands.AddRawModule, {rawModuleId, symbolsURL, rawModule}) as Promise<string[]>; } /** * Notifies the plugin that a script is removed. */ removeRawModule(rawModuleId: string): Promise<void> { return this.endpoint.sendRequest(PrivateAPI.LanguageExtensionPluginCommands.RemoveRawModule, {rawModuleId}) as Promise<void>; } /** Find locations in raw modules from a location in a source file */ sourceLocationToRawLocation(sourceLocation: Chrome.DevTools.SourceLocation): Promise<Chrome.DevTools.RawLocationRange[]> { return this.endpoint.sendRequest( PrivateAPI.LanguageExtensionPluginCommands.SourceLocationToRawLocation, {sourceLocation}) as Promise<Chrome.DevTools.RawLocationRange[]>; } /** Find locations in source files from a location in a raw module */ rawLocationToSourceLocation(rawLocation: Chrome.DevTools.RawLocation): Promise<Chrome.DevTools.SourceLocation[]> { return this.endpoint.sendRequest( PrivateAPI.LanguageExtensionPluginCommands.RawLocationToSourceLocation, {rawLocation}) as Promise<Chrome.DevTools.SourceLocation[]>; } getScopeInfo(type: string): Promise<Chrome.DevTools.ScopeInfo> { return this.endpoint.sendRequest(PrivateAPI.LanguageExtensionPluginCommands.GetScopeInfo, {type}) as Promise<Chrome.DevTools.ScopeInfo>; } /** List all variables in lexical scope at a given location in a raw module */ listVariablesInScope(rawLocation: Chrome.DevTools.RawLocation): Promise<Chrome.DevTools.Variable[]> { return this.endpoint.sendRequest(PrivateAPI.LanguageExtensionPluginCommands.ListVariablesInScope, {rawLocation}) as Promise<Chrome.DevTools.Variable[]>; } /** List all function names (including inlined frames) at location */ getFunctionInfo(rawLocation: Chrome.DevTools.RawLocation): Promise<{ frames: Array<Chrome.DevTools.FunctionInfo>, }> { return this.endpoint.sendRequest(PrivateAPI.LanguageExtensionPluginCommands.GetFunctionInfo, {rawLocation}) as Promise<{ frames: Array<Chrome.DevTools.FunctionInfo>, }>; } /** Find locations in raw modules corresponding to the inline function * that rawLocation is in. */ getInlinedFunctionRanges(rawLocation: Chrome.DevTools.RawLocation): Promise<Chrome.DevTools.RawLocationRange[]> { return this.endpoint.sendRequest( PrivateAPI.LanguageExtensionPluginCommands.GetInlinedFunctionRanges, {rawLocation}) as Promise<Chrome.DevTools.RawLocationRange[]>; } /** Find locations in raw modules corresponding to inline functions * called by the function or inline frame that rawLocation is in. */ getInlinedCalleesRanges(rawLocation: Chrome.DevTools.RawLocation): Promise<Chrome.DevTools.RawLocationRange[]> { return this.endpoint.sendRequest( PrivateAPI.LanguageExtensionPluginCommands.GetInlinedCalleesRanges, {rawLocation}) as Promise<Chrome.DevTools.RawLocationRange[]>; } async getMappedLines(rawModuleId: string, sourceFileURL: string): Promise<number[]|undefined> { return this.endpoint.sendRequest( PrivateAPI.LanguageExtensionPluginCommands.GetMappedLines, {rawModuleId, sourceFileURL}); } async evaluate(expression: string, context: Chrome.DevTools.RawLocation, stopId: number): Promise<Chrome.DevTools.RemoteObject> { return this.endpoint.sendRequest( PrivateAPI.LanguageExtensionPluginCommands.FormatValue, {expression, context, stopId}); } getProperties(objectId: Chrome.DevTools.RemoteObjectId): Promise<Chrome.DevTools.PropertyDescriptor[]> { return this.endpoint.sendRequest(PrivateAPI.LanguageExtensionPluginCommands.GetProperties, {objectId}); } releaseObject(objectId: Chrome.DevTools.RemoteObjectId): Promise<void> { return this.endpoint.sendRequest(PrivateAPI.LanguageExtensionPluginCommands.ReleaseObject, {objectId}); } }
